The National Peanut Board (NPB) was thrilled to be part of the 49th Annual Georgia Peanut Farm Show and Conference, held January 14–15, 2026, at the University of Georgia Tifton Campus Conference Center. With more than 1,800 attendees, the event was buzzing with excitement and provided the perfect opportunity for NPB to connect face-to-face with peanut growers and industry partners who fuel the future of peanuts.

NPB made a big splash with a center-stage booth alongside the Georgia Peanut Commission’s main tent (home of the fan-favorite grilled peanut butter sandwiches, as good as they sound!). Attendees explored 2025 promotions highlight videos, interactive allergy-awareness activities through Little Peanut, and snagged plenty of popular NPB merch. The booth also sparked early excitement around NPB’s “One Brand, One Industry” vision, including a sneak peek at the upcoming “It’s Not Nuts. It’s Peanuts.” brand launch coming this April.

During the luncheon, industry growers and partners were honored with several career awards celebrating their contributions to the peanut industry. Adding to the energy, NPB’s own Chris Fitzgerald took the stage to share a clear and motivating message: NPB is committed to supporting 7,000 U.S. peanut farming families, driving consumer demand, advancing efforts to eradicate peanut allergies, while championing U.S. peanut farmers through continued investments that strengthen peanut quality and increase yields.
